Rescue FAQs

Little paws doggie rescue is an all volunteer non-profit small dog rescue. Our goal is to rescue senior, injured, hard to place, pregnant, nursing dogs and puppies and even some just plain old regular small doggies. We function solely on donations from people like you.
Sacramento, placer, El Dorado and YOLO
  • 1. Submit Application
  • 2. Interview
  • 3. Approve Application
  • 4. Meet the Pet
  • 5. Home Check
  • 6. Sign Adoption Contract
  • 7. Pay Fee

Additional adoption info

The adoption process maybe stopped at any time if you or the foster parent does not feel it's a good match.
